Binary package “sipvicious” in ubuntu jammy
tools to audit SIP based VoIP systems
SIPVicious suite is a set of tools that can be used
to audit SIP based VoIP systems. This suite has five
tools: svmap, svwar, svcrack, svreport, svcrash.
.
svmap is a sip scanner. When launched against ranges
of ip address space, it will identify any SIP servers
which it finds on the way.
.
svwar identifies working extension lines on a PBX.
Also tells you if extension line requires authentication or not.
.
svcrack is a password cracker making use of digest authentication.
It is able to crack passwords on both registrar servers and proxy
servers.
.
svreport is able to manage sessions created by the rest of the tools
and export to pdf, xml, csv and plain text.
.
svcrash responds to svwar and svcrack SIP messages with a message
that causes old versions to crash.
